Biography

Athens, Georgia band R.E.M. were one of the most influential bands in the formation of alternative rock and indie, and became one of the biggest rock groups in the world in the early 1990s. Initially inspiring an underground following, their popularity then blossomed into mainstream success, their touring venues changing from cramped bars to expansive sports arenas and festival stages, over a… Read more in Amazon's R.E.M. REM Bang And Blame (Scarce 1994 UK 4-track CD single Part Two of a 2 CD set including live versions of Losing My Religion Country Feedback and Begin The Begin recorded in Athens GA for Greenpeace lyric picture sleeve W0275CD)

4.0 out of 5 stars Overall, pretty darn nice, October 28, 2000
This review is from: Bang & Blame / Losing My Religion (Audio CD)
As R.E.M. Maxi-Singles go, this is a tad disappointing. They usual produce great B-Sides, but for Monster, they opted for all live tracks of previously release material. A lot of jewels in them, but this CD is one of the lesser efforts.

"Bang and Blame" is a great rock song. At times, Stipe seems a little of his element, though. The verses are great, but the rocking chorus doesn't always come off as well as it probably could. Still, the great playing of Mills, Buck, and Berry are all excellent and produce a really strong track.

"Losing My Religion" is the first live track. Not much to be said. It's "Losing My Religion" live. It always sounds the same to me, and this is not the first time a live version of the song made its way into a B-Side. I think the band has just gotten into a groove for doing this song. Its always really good, but never great.

"Country Feedback" is a very nice inclusion, though. A fan favorite, its simple beauty comes across very well here. You can tell that Michael Stipe really enjoys singing this. A beautiful rendition.

"Begin the Begin" is another fan fav which closes out the single. The performance is good, although the recording left something to be desired. Still, it is a live recording, so you get about what you should expect.

Overall, I don't consider this album a must buy. If you like either "Country Feedback" or "Begin the Begin", though, you won't be disappointed by the versions you'll find here. Not a great single, but pretty darn nice.

5.0 out of 5 stars Banging Song, May 17, 2001
This review is from: Bang & Blame / Losing My Religion (Audio CD)
"Bang & Blame" is the best song from R.E.M.'s great Monster album. The song has a sinister sound to it with a pulsating bass line and a wicked guitar. Michael Stipe sings with a sneering drawl and it is just a tremendous track. The three live songs are also well worth it. "Losing My Religion" is solid, but "Country Feedback" is tremendous and the old Lifes Rich Pageant "Begin The Begin" is excellent.
